Advanced Testing Protocols Simulate Failures and Validate Antioxidant Polyethylene in Ankle Implants

open access: yesJournal of Orthopaedic Research, EarlyView.
Abstract Total ankle replacement (TAR) has become an effective treatment for end‐stage ankle osteoarthritis. Multiple factors, including patient characteristics, surgical technique, alignment, and bearing surfaces, influence TAR survivorship. Polyethylene (PE) fatigue is a key consideration in improving outcomes.
